@emergn/design-system-tokens

1.1.19 • Public • Published

Emergn Design Tokens

Emergn design token package that is transformed and ready to use with help of Amazon's Style Dictionary.

Installation

To install, you can use npm.

$ npm install @emergn/design-system-tokens

Getting Started

JS

  • Import tokens file into component:

    import tokens from '@emergn/design-system-tokens/assets/tokens/tokens.js’;
  • Or use as a constant:

    const  tokens = require('@emergn/design-system-tokens/assets/tokens/tokens');

SCSS

  • Import tokens:

     @import '@emergn/design-system-tokens/assets/tokens/tokens';
  • Import styles:

     @import '@emergn/design-system-tokens/assets/styles/styles'; 

Changelog

[1.1.19] - 2022-09-12

Improvement

  • Improved typography mixin (DS-587)

[1.1.18] - 2022-07-28

Refactoring

  • Renamed icon folder from 'dist' to 'icons' (DS-547)

Improvement

  • Changed breakpoint mixin naming (DS-549)

Tokens added

  • Added tokens for container focus state
  • Added tokens for datepicker (form tokens)

[1.1.17] - 2022-03-18

Tokens added

  • Added tokens for disabled button

[1.1.16] - 2022-03-10

Updates

  • Updated shadow tokens (from single shadow to multiple)
  • Adjusted 'shadow' mixin to work with multiple shadows
  • Updated notification and link tokens
  • Added favicons

[1.1.15] - 2022-02-14

Updates

  • Added CopyPaste icon
  • Added tokens for link colors ($colors-link-*)
  • Updated shadows tokens

Improvement

  • Optimized SVG & created JSON files from SVG

[1.1.14] - 2022-01-27

Bugfix

  • Fixed deprecation warning regarding icon line-width calculations

[1.1.13] - 2022-01-27

Tokens updated

  • Updated icon padding tokens
  • Updated cotainer max-width tokens ($container-maxwidths-*)
  • Updated container colors tokens
  • Last tag tokens renamed (pressed to active)

Styles

  • Adjusted icon-size mixin to use new padding tokens
  • Added gutter mixins (@mixin container-horizontal-gutters, @mixin container-vertical-gutters)

[1.1.12] - 2022-01-17

Tokens updated

  • Renamed tokens for tag colors (pressed to active)

Tokens added

  • Added tokens for container colors
    • $colors-container-background-success
    • $colors-container-background-warning
    • $colors-container-background-critical
    • $colors-container-background-information

[1.1.10] - 2022-01-14

Improvement

  • Added changelog

[1.1.9] - 2022-01-14

Tokens added

  • Added tokens for container colors ($colors-container-*)

[1.1.8] - 2022-01-12

BREAKING CHANGE

  • Token $form-content-padding was changed on
    • $form-content-paddinghorizontal-sm
    • $form-content-paddinghorizontal-lg
  • Token $form-content-spacing was changed on
    • $form-content-spacing-sm
    • $form-content-spacing-lg

Tokens added

  • Added tokens for vertical padding in forms
  • Added tokens for tag groups

Bugfix

  • Fixed 'shadow' mixin

[1.1.7] - 2022-01-12

Tokens updated

  • Updated tokens for container paddings

[1.1.6] - 2022-01-10

Bugfix

  • Added icon size rounding in 'icon-size' mixin

[1.1.5] - 2022-01-10

Improvement

  • Ajusted icon size calculations in 'icon-size' mixin

[1.1.4] - 2022-01-10

BREAKING CHANGE

  • Shadow tokens get type property, and it breaks 'shadow' mixin (fixed in 1.1.8)

Tokens added

  • Added tokens $spacing-none, $padding-4, $padding-none
  • Added tokens for container paddings and spacings
  • Added tokens for container corner radius

Bugfix

  • Adjusted icon line-width in 'icon-size' mixin

[1.1.3] - 2021-12-24

Bugfix

  • Fixed bug in typography mixin

[1.1.2] - 2021-12-24

BREAKING CHANGE

  • Updated icons on the orignal streamline to fix rendering issues
  • Updated 'icon-size' mixin according to the new icons
  • Removed 'map-deep-get' function, now use 'map.get' function from sass

Readme

Keywords

none

Package Sidebar

Install

npm i @emergn/design-system-tokens

Weekly Downloads

0

Version

1.1.19

License

MIT

Unpacked Size

9.59 MB

Total Files

3496

Last publish

Collaborators

  • joao.pedro.ferreira
  • zlipinskis
  • iivanova
  • nlastukhina-emergn
  • dzakharova
  • emikhailova
  • pbasha